项目摘要
A number of the cellular genes which upon mutation are capable of
inducing cellular transformation (proto-oncogenes) have recently
been identified as components involved in the normal cellular
growth pathways. Recently, the oncogene responsible for avian
erythroblastosis, erb B, has been shown to represent a truncated
version of the epidermal growth factor receptor (EGF-R). This
oncogene offers a unique opportunity to study the relationship
between growth factor receptors and leukemia, and the process of
oncogenic conversion of a normal cellular gene. It has been
demonstrated that the c-erb B gene is mutated consistently in
leukemia induced by a non-acute retrovirus. The mutation by viral
DNA insertion is very specific and reproducible results in the
production of a truncated c-erb B/EGF-R gene product that contains
only the protein kinase domain. Presumably, this process
constitutively activates the EGF-R receptor function leading to the
uncontrolled growth of the target cell. In an effort to better
understand the molecular basis for this process, the c-DNA clones
corresponding to the activated c-erb B/EGF-R gene have been
isolated from leukemic cells. Using these clones, we have
constructed an avian leukemia model by inserting an activated c-
erb B gene into a competent retroviral vector. The Rous/erb B
virus (REB) is leukemogenic in chickens and appears to have tissue
specificity. In this study we plan to: 1) Further characterize
the REB virus and define the oncogenic determinants of its c-erb
B gene product using site specific in vitro mutagenesis techniques;
2) Characterize the biochemical properties of the c-erb B gene
product in its activated form and in its proto-oncogene form; 3)
Determine the effect of activated c-erb B expression on the
abrogation of growth factor dependence of hematopoietic cells.
